Why Altamont Electricians Recommend Regular Maintenance
Altamont electricians emphasize preventive maintenance as the most cost-effective way to protect property. A proactive schedule may include:
- Annual torque checks on breaker lugs to prevent arcing.
- Infrared scans that detect hidden hot spots in conductors before they char insulation.
- Cleaning of generator carburetors and oil changes prior to storm season.
- Re-testing of smoke detectors and carbon-monoxide alarms.
- Inspection of surge-protective devices following significant lightning events.
These measures extend hardware lifespan, reduce energy waste, and—most importantly—protect occupants.
Energy Efficiency Advice From Electricians in Altamont
Efficient electricity use lowers bills and eases strain on the regional grid. Electricians in Altamont share several practical recommendations:
- Upgrade incandescent bulbs to ENERGY STAR LEDs that use 75% less power and last 25 times longer.
- Install smart switches or dimmers in high-traffic rooms to cut runtime when full brightness is unnecessary.
- Schedule a panel inspection to verify circuits are balanced; unbalanced loads increase line loss.
- Consider solar installation with net-metering agreements to offset afternoon peaks.
- Replace two-prong receptacles with grounded GFCI or AFCI outlets to boost safety and support modern electronics.
Implementing even a few of these suggestions can yield noticeable savings within the first billing cycle.

Altamont Electricians and Rural Resilience
Remote cabins and farmsteads face challenges unfamiliar to urban dwellings—long feeder runs, limited broadband, and fluctuating voltage. Altamont electricians build resilience by:
- Installing line conditioners and automatic voltage regulators to stabilize power.
- Employing thicker-gauge conductors over extended distances to reduce drop.
- Strategically placing sub-panels to isolate critical loads for generator support.
- Adding Wi-Fi extenders alongside smart devices to maintain remote monitoring capabilities.
These measures keep rural residents comfortable and productive, even when the nearest hardware store sits miles away.

Staying Connected: Why an Electrician Altamont Trusts Is Essential
The modern household depends on connectivity. Smart thermostats, security cameras, and streaming devices all draw modest loads but require stable voltage and reliable data loops. An electrician Altamont families trust ensures:
- Properly grounded circuits to prevent data loss during surges.
- Dedicated receptacles for network equipment to reduce interference.
- Thoughtful routing of low-voltage cabling to avoid electromagnetic fields from high-current lines.
- Battery backup integration so routers remain powered during outages.
With these elements in place, inhabitants stay connected whether they are telecommuting, monitoring livestock via IoT sensors, or simply enjoying movie night.
